Cut off saw operator gender statistics
11.6% of cut off saw operators are women and 88.4% of cut off saw operators are men.
- Male, 88.4%
- Female, 11.6%
Cut off saw operator gender ratio
| Gender | Percentages |
|---|---|
| Male | 88.4% |
| Female | 11.6% |
Cut off saw operator gender pay gap
Women earn 94¢ for every $1 earned by men
Male income
$29,770
Female income
$28,026

Cut off saw operator demographics by race
The most common ethnicity among cut off saw operators is White, which makes up 65.2% of all cut off saw operators. Comparatively, 17.0% of cut off saw operators are Hispanic or Latino and 11.0% of cut off saw operators are Black or African American.
- White, 65.2%
- Hispanic or Latino, 17.0%
- Black or African American, 11.0%
- Unknown, 4.8%
- Asian, 1.1%
- American Indian and Alaska Native, 0.9%

Cut off saw operator wage gap by race
According to our data, white cut off saw operators have the highest average salary compared to other ethnicities. Asian cut off saw operators have the lowest average salary at $28,321.
| Ethnicity | Salary |
|---|---|
| Unknown | $30,000 |
| White | $30,718 |
| Black or African American | $29,999 |
| Asian | $28,321 |
| Hispanic or Latino | $29,865 |

Cut off saw operator wage gap by degree level
According to the data, cut off saw operators with a Bachelor's degree earn more than those without, at $31,836 annually. With a High School Diploma degree, cut off saw operators earn a median annual income of $31,459 compared to $30,806 for cut off saw operators with an Associate degree.
| Education | Salary |
|---|---|
| High School Diploma or Less | $31,459 |
| Bachelor's Degree | $31,836 |
| Some College/ Associate Degree | $30,806 |

Cut off saw operator turnover and employment statistics
Cut off saw operator unemployment rate over time
The unemployment rate for cut off saw operators between 2008 and the most recent data has varied, according to the Bureau of Labor Statistics.
Cut off saw operator unemployment rate by year
| Year | Cut off saw operator unemployment rate |
|---|---|
| 2010 | 14.22% |
| 2011 | 13.25% |
| 2012 | 13.04% |
| 2013 | 11.11% |
| 2014 | 4.90% |
| 2015 | 6.30% |
| 2016 | 4.83% |
| 2017 | 4.50% |
| 2018 | 2.82% |
| 2019 | 3.42% |
| 2020 | 3.49% |
| 2021 | 6.19% |
Average cut off saw operator tenure
The average cut off saw operator stays at their job for 1-2 years, based on the 150 cut off saw operators resumes in Zippia's database.
Cut off saw operator tenure statistics
| Number of years | Percentages |
|---|---|
| Less than 1 year | 26% |
| 1-2 years | 32% |
| 3-4 years | 12% |
| 5-7 years | 17% |
| 8-10 years | 5% |
| 11+ years | 8% |
